On this Fourth Sunday of Advent, Reverend John Gorin explores the profound significance behind the name given to the Messiah: Jesus. Based on the Gospel of Matthew and the account of Joseph’s dream, this sermon examines the fulfillment of Old Testament prophecy and the dual nature of Christ as both the human Son of David and the Divine Son of God.

Rev. Gorin unpacks the Hebrew roots of the name "Yeshua" (The Lord Saves) and challenges listeners to consider what it means to truly live under that authority today. The message moves beyond viewing salvation solely as a future event, presenting it as a present reality that grants believers a new, transcendent identity.

Key Topics Covered:

The Prophecy Fulfilled: Understanding Matthew 1 and the connection to Isaiah 7:14.

The Meaning of the Name: How "Jesus" signifies both human history and divine intervention.

Identity in Christ: Shedding the "old garments" of social status and past idols to embrace a unified identity in the Church.

Power and Healing: The importance of praying expectantly for healing in Jesus' name.

Reverence: Recovering a sense of awe and holiness in our approach to the Lord.

Scripture References: Matthew 1:18-25, Isaiah 7:14, Acts 4:12, Philippians 2:9-11.
